Best time to swim in Gaspé (Gaspé Peninsula): the water temperature by month

Month Sea temperature
January 31°F (min: 28°F/max: 35°F)
February 30°F (min: 29°F/max: 32°F)
March 30°F (min: 29°F/max: 31°F)
April 33°F (min: 29°F/max: 37°F)
May 40°F (min: 33°F/max: 47°F)
June 50°F (min: 44°F/max: 57°F)
July 59°F (min: 54°F/max: 63°F)
August 60°F (min: 57°F/max: 64°F)
September 54°F (min: 49°F/max: 60°F)
October 47°F (min: 41°F/max: 53°F)
November 41°F (min: 34°F/max: 47°F)
December 35°F (min: 29°F/max: 40°F)
